The foundation of **how to set iPhone to long exposure** begins with recognizing that iPhones don’t natively support shutter speeds longer than 1/250th of a second. This hardware constraint forces photographers to adopt alternative strategies, primarily through third-party applications that simulate long exposure effects. Apps like Slow Shutter Cam, NightCap Camera, or ProCamera offer manual controls, including bulb mode (which holds the shutter open indefinitely) and adjustable exposure times—features absent in the default Camera app. The workflow itself is deceptively simple but demands precision. First, you’ll need to stabilize your iPhone using a tripod or a flat, vibration-resistant surface to avoid blur from camera shake. Next, you’ll open a long exposure app, switch to bulb mode, and manually trigger the shutter. The real artistry comes in calculating the ideal exposure time: too short, and you’ll miss the effect; too long, and you risk overexposure or noise. For instance, capturing light trails at night might require 5–10 seconds, while a waterfall could need 1–3 seconds. Mastering **how to set iPhone to long exposure** hinges on experimenting with these variables while accounting for ambient light conditions.Historical Background and Evolution

At its core, long exposure photography exploits the camera’s ability to accumulate light over an extended period. When you set your iPhone to long exposure using an app like NightCap Camera, you’re essentially bypassing the default auto-exposure system. Bulb mode, for example, keeps the shutter open until you manually close it, giving you granular control over exposure time. This manual override is critical because iPhones lack a physical shutter button, so most apps require you to hold a virtual button or use a wired remote shutter to avoid introducing motion. The sensor’s performance during long exposures is another critical factor. iPhones use backside-illuminated (BSI) sensors in newer models, which improve light sensitivity and reduce noise in low-light conditions. However, prolonged exposures can still introduce graininess or color shifts, especially in older devices. To mitigate this, many long exposure apps include noise reduction algorithms or allow you to shoot in RAW format for post-processing flexibility. Q: Can I achieve long exposure without a third-party app?
A: No, iPhones lack native long exposure modes, so third-party apps like Slow Shutter Cam or NightCap Camera are essential. These apps provide bulb mode and manual controls that the default Camera app cannot offer.
Q: What’s the best tripod for iPhone long exposure?
A: A sturdy mini tripod with a ball head (like the Joby GorillaPod or Manfrotto Pixi) is ideal. Avoid ultra-lightweight tripods, as they may introduce vibrations during long exposures. For added stability, use a remote shutter or the app’s timer function.
Q: Why does my long exposure photo look noisy?
A: Noise (graininess) in long exposure shots is common due to the sensor accumulating light over time. To reduce noise, shoot in RAW format (if your app supports it), use the lowest ISO setting possible, and avoid overexposing the image. Post-processing tools like Lightroom can also help.
Q: How do I calculate the right exposure time for light trails?
A: Start with a 5–10 second exposure for city light trails. If the image is too dark, increase the time; if it’s overexposed, reduce it. Use the app’s live histogram to gauge exposure. For moving subjects (like cars), begin with 1–2 seconds and adjust based on their speed.

Q: What’s the difference between bulb mode and long exposure?
A: Bulb mode is a type of long exposure where the shutter remains open until manually closed, giving you full control over exposure time. Traditional long exposure (in DSLRs) uses fixed shutter speeds like 1/4s or 1s. On iPhones, bulb mode is the closest equivalent to manual long exposure.
Q: Are there any iPhone models better suited for long exposure?
A: Newer iPhones with larger sensors (e.g., iPhone 12 Pro and later) perform better in low light, reducing noise in long exposures. However, the quality of your shot depends more on technique (stabilization, app settings) than the model itself.
